“二战”时惨遭日军蹂躏的经历对战后澳大利亚对日媾和产生了重大影响,澳大利亚的态度经历了由强硬到妥协的变化。这种变化是符合澳大利亚自身利益需要的。在“黄祸论”思想、“二战”的惨痛经验、经济竞争力低下以及自主外交的影响下,澳大利亚坚决主张对日强硬;但是随着新中国的成立和朝鲜战争的爆发,对日本侵略的恐惧被共产主义威胁替代,战时澳美的合作及战后英国的衰弱,使得澳大利亚寻求美国的保护,双方经过多次会谈后签订了军事同盟协定,澳大利亚最终在自身安全得到美国保障的前提下与日本签订了和平条约。
